About Margo’s Catfish Diner in North Little Rock
Tucked away on Willow Street in North Little Rock, Margo’s Catfish Diner is a hidden gem that’s quickly becoming a local favorite. This small, unassuming restaurant may not look like much from the outside, but step inside and you’ll be greeted by the mouthwatering aroma of freshly fried catfish and the warm, friendly hospitality that’s the hallmark of true Southern hospitality.
The menu at Margo’s is a celebration of classic New American cuisine with a distinct Southern twist. The star of the show is undoubtedly the catfish, which is sourced locally and fried to perfection in a light, crispy batter. But the menu also features a variety of other delectable dishes, from hearty plates of fried chicken and collard greens to lighter options like the refreshing mustard slaw.
